Gran Turismo 7 PC port not in development, says developer

Gran Turismo 7

Previously we reported on Gran Turismo 7 possibly getting a PC port – as the game remains exclusive to PlayStation consoles.

Series creator Kazunori Yamauchi made a statement that hinted the latest in their racing franchise might be finally coming to PC.

This brought about hopes for some fans that Gran Turismo 7 might be seeing a port to PC. However, the racing boss has now shut down these rumors, which all started after his original statements.

“That’s not true,” Yamauchi said to Dengeki (via @Genki_JPN) when asked whether or not Polyphony Digital are developing a PC version of Gran Turismo.

“[…] Simply, if you ask me ‘are you doing anything concrete?’ I am not doing anything. There is nothing to talk about,” he added, confirming there is no Gran Turismo 7 PC port development being done right now.

While this doesn’t rule out the series coming to PC, it does confirm that not only are they not working on a PC port, but that a PC port will not be arriving anytime soon. So those hoping for Gran Turismo on the PC will be disappointed for the long wait.

In other news, the franchise has celebrated its 25th anniversary alongside the announcement that the series has reached over 90 million lifetime sales. A film based on the video game is also currently filming and set to release next year.
